The Rich Little Show is an American sketch variety show hosted by Rich Little that aired on NBC in 1975-1976.

E1. Show #1
Feb 2, 1976 · 60m
Glenn Ford appears with a group of performing Dalmations. Susan Saint James performs a tap dance routine. John Davidson sings a medley of songs "Feelings", "Mandy" and "My Eyes Adored". Regulars are Charlotte Rae and Julie McWhirter. Rich Little's sheep-dog Dudley is also a regular.
